Definitions:

Liberal Feminism

A perspective within feminism that emphasizes individual rights and equal opportunity as the basis for gender equality.

Intersectionality Theory

A model that explains the way various elements of an individual's social and political identities intersect, leading to diverse forms of discrimination and privilege.

Socialist Feminism

An ideological movement that calls for an end to capitalism and patriarchy, advocating for a society where women's liberation is achieved through economic and social equality.

Psychoanalytic Feminism

A branch of feminist theory applying psychoanalytic principles to explore the foundations of gender inequality and the psyche.
